在SEO行业中,蜘蛛池程序被广泛应用于网站优化和排名提升的工作中。蜘蛛池程序能够自动模拟搜索引擎蜘蛛对网站进行抓取和索引,从而帮助站长了解自己网站的真实收录情况,并对网站进行针对性的优化。
蜘蛛池程序的原理是通过模拟搜索引擎蜘蛛的抓取行为,将网站页面有效地抓取到本地数据库中,并对抓取的数据进行处理和分析,以便站长深入了解网站的收录情况、站点结构以及关键词排名等数据信息。通过蜘蛛池程序,站长可以实时了解自己网站的收录情况,及时发现网站的问题,并进行相应的优化工作。
要想自制蜘蛛池程序,首先需要明确自己的需求和目标,确定要抓取的网站范围和抓取频率,然后选择合适的技术方案进行实现。一般来说,自制蜘蛛池可以采用Python、Java、PHP等语言进行开发,选择合适的数据库存储抓取数据,使用代理IP和反爬虫策略保障程序的稳定运行。此外,还可以结合定时任务、消息队列等技术实现蜘蛛池的自动抓取和数据处理。
在自制蜘蛛池过程中,需要注意遵守网络爬虫的相关法律法规,不得擅自侵犯他人网站的合法权益。同时,要加强对反爬虫机制的应对,避免被目标网站封禁IP或账号。另外,蜘蛛池程序的稳定性和效率也是需要重点考虑的问题,要给程序合理的资源和运行环境,保证程序的高效运行。
总的来说,蜘蛛池程序在SEO行业中扮演着非常重要的角色,通过自制蜘蛛池可以更好地实现对网站的监控和优化工作,为网站的长期发展提供有力的数据支持。